Most Marketing Fails for One Reason: It’s Too General

Most marketing doesn’t fail because you need a new funnel.

It fails because your message is broad.

👉 General marketing attracts general results.

When your content sounds like it’s meant for everyone, it feels relevant to no one.

And if a prospect doesn’t feel like you’re speaking directly to them, they keep scrolling.


The Mistake Almost Everyone Makes

Most agents try to appeal to everyone.

It usually sounds like:

  • “I help with financial planning.”
  • “I help families with insurance.”
  • “I can shop multiple carriers.”
  • “I do life, health, Medicare, annuities, and more.”

That might be true…

But it’s not memorable.

And it doesn’t give prospects a reason to choose you over the next agent they see online.


The Shift Tracy Made: Go All In on One Clear Identity

Instead of trying to be the “everything” agent…

Tracy made his positioning simple:

👉 “I’m the annuity guy.”

That one decision changes everything because it creates instant clarity.

When someone sees your content, they immediately know:

  • what you specialize in
  • what you help with
  • whether you’re relevant to them

And clarity is what creates trust.


Why Specific Wins

When your message is clear:

✅ the right people lean in
✅ the wrong people filter out

And that’s exactly what you want.

Most agents are scared of filtering people out.

But filtering is the point.

If you’re attracting everyone, you’re attracting:

  • time-wasters
  • price shoppers
  • low-intent leads
  • people who aren’t aligned with your ideal business

Specific positioning protects your calendar.

What You Should Do Instead

Ask yourself three questions:

  1. What do I want to be known for?
  2. Who do I want to attract?
  3. What problem do I solve best?

Then build everything around that:

  • your website
  • your headline
  • your social content
  • your lead magnets
  • your follow-up sequences
  • your offers

When your marketing has one clear identity, everything gets easier.
